Success in LA
Monday, December 19, 2011 was the start to a whirl wind week of travel and meetings and exciting news! I left Denver on Monday night around 6:30 and flew to LA to meet my IP's and see my friend Karen! After arriving in LA about 1/2 an hour late we jumped in the car to get to the hotel where my IP's were waiting for us. We arrived at the valet and still needed a little primping...changing shoes, earrings, scarves, and coats! I am not a fashionta and needed friends to help make the perfect outfit for our first meeting..the shoes were too small and I don't wear hoop earrings (Carrie said I had to wear them).
I was so nervous I thought I was going to pass out! The guys were waiting for us in the bar and I saw them right away. Lots of hugs and introductions! After a drink and dinner it was time to get a little sleep! We checked into our hotel and didn't get much sleep but were ready to go, on time, (which is hard for Karen) by 8:00 the next morning! After waiting for quite a while at the clinic we finally got in to see the Dr. and let me tell you he was worth the wait. He is hilarious...there was a lot of sarcasm and a lot of good news! He only does day 5 transfers, which means 2 less days of travel for Tucker and I! He also worked around my schedule for an end of March transfer and uses a lot less medication than I was anticipating!
After I passed the exam Karen and I were good to go exploring while the guys were at their appointment.
We met for lunch and talked and talked and talked, about how to leave a tip and how to get to Rodeo Drive and the Hollywood sign. I had such a great time getting to know my IP's and am so excited to get this process started. It struck me at the appointment how vulnerable the guys must feel. They have no idea who I really am as a person and have to trust that I will do everything I am told. It takes special people to have that much faith in another person! I will do everything I am told, when I am told to do it! It was such a great day and I can't wait to see them again! It's hard to believe that the next time I see them will be at an ultrasound!

The Journey Begins
I am about to embark on an amazing journey! One that will take me back and forth to LA with my new bestest friends from across the pond! I have decided, that after the birth of my son I wanted to pay it forward to those who needed it most! I will begin my journey of gestational surrogacy on Monday, December 19, 2011 with a flight to LA to meet my Intended Parents (IP's). They will continue to only be called my IP's or the guys throughout this blog or until they tell me otherwise. I met my IP's over Skype on November 20, 2011...how fitting that we will begin our journey with the medical screening one month later on December 20, 2011!
